It is well-known that the set of points in having unique -expansion, in other words, those points whose orbits under greedy -transformation escape a hole depending on , is of zero Lebesgue measure. The corresponding escape rate is investigated in this paper. A formula which links the Hausdorff dimension of univoque set and escape rate is established in this study. Then we also proved that such rate forms a devil's staircase function with respect to .
